Math can be an arduous study for some children, but put some manipulatives and games in their hands and it sometimes becomes much more comprehensible. I hope you’ll find these materials helpful for you and your children.


Materials
- Protractor: Print, laminate, and cut these protractors for student use. You can give them one to keep at home and one to keep at school.
- Ruler: These 7 inch/17 cm rulers can be printed on card stock. Send them home, give everyone a ruler for their desk, and one to keep in their backpack. They resemble the rulers used on standardized tests, so your students will be very comfortable with them by the time testing arrives.
- Thermometer: Student practice thermometers for small and large group practice.
